Transaction 7c51b9fde61d8a089d4f522643e612152b3037bf6cc736bb174041b35a970b36

2 Input
2 Outputs
  • 7c51b9fde61d8a089d4f522643e612152b3037bf6cc736bb174041b35a970b36:0
  • value  63636
    address  12jiH3zt3EaEvFMYVXmZGvabUjkzJUYkWd
  • 7c51b9fde61d8a089d4f522643e612152b3037bf6cc736bb174041b35a970b36:1
  • value  2145530394
    address  3EC6GCRBCbLGBTHL3xJNUeDeQMELmZsUcD